SIDBI, Federal Bank join hands to boost MSME financing
Mumbai, March 6: The Small Industries Development Bank of India (SIDBI) and The Federal Bank Limited (FBL) on Thursday announced that they have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to provide financial support to mic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s).
Kerala Police applauded for swift arrest in Federal Bank heist case
Thrissur, Feb 17: After facing criticism from several quarters, the Kerala Police won praise on Monday for their swift action in arresting Rijo Antony, a local resident of Chalakudy, in connection with the daring daylight heist at the Federal Bank branch in Pota, near Chalakudy, Thrissur.
Rs 15 lakh Kerala bank heist: Police expect breakthrough soon
Kochi, Feb 15: A day after a daring daylight bank heist at the Federal Bank branch in Pota, near Chalakudy, Thrissur, police are yet to make a breakthrough despite extensive efforts. However, investigators are confident of cracking the case soon.
Armed robbery at Federal Bank branch in Thrissur, Rs 15 lakh looted
Thrissur, Feb 14: In a broad daylight bank heist, a man armed with a knife stormed into the Federal Bank branch at Pota, near Chalakudy, Thrissur, around 2:15 p.m. on Friday and made off with approximately Rs 15 lakh after threatening the bank staff.
Kerala: Leading banker calls on Pinarayi Vijayan
Kochi, Feb 13: K.V.S. Manian, CEO and MD of Federal Bank, the country's sixth biggest private sector bank on Thursday called on Kerala Chief Minister Pinarayi Vijayan and discussed avenues for collaboration and growth.
